The contract solicits quotes for two units of a quick release pin, identified by NSN 0QM 5315 017216798 and part number CL-5-BLPB-1.00-S. This procurement requires government source approval prior to award; therefore, vendors must submit detailed source approval information along with their proposal as outlined in the NAVSUP WSS Source Approval Brochure. Failure to provide this documentation will result in non-consideration of the offer. The contract includes specific quality requirements and an inspection and acceptance process to ensure compliance with standards. It mandates the use of Workflow Pro for payment instructions and adheres to a 12-month warranty for the supplies, with a 60-day period after discovery for defect claims. The solicitation is issued by the Department of Defense’s Navsup Weapon Systems Support office located in Philadelphia, PA, with submission deadlines specified for June 29, 2026. It incorporates various regulatory clauses such as Buy American and Free Trade Agreements provisions, equal opportunity requirements for workers with disabilities, security prohibitions, and national defense priority rating. Payment will follow wide area workflow procedures, and all proposals must be submitted via email to the designated contract point of contact. Awards may proceed without source approval if processing delays conflict with fleet support needs.

CONTACT INFORMATION|4|TBD |TBD |TBD |TBD | ITEM UNIQUE IDENTIFICATION AND VALUATION (JAN 2023)|19|||||||||||||||||||| HIGHER-LEVEL CONTRACT QUALITY REQUIREMENT|8|X|||||||| INSPECTION AND ACCEPTANCE OF SUPPLIES|26|X||||||||||||X|||||||||||||| WIDE AREA WORKFLOW PAYMENT INSTRUCTIONS (JAN 2023)|16|INVOICE AND RECEIVING REPORT COMBO TYPE|N/A|TBD|N00383|TBD|TBD|SEE SCHEDULE|TBD|||TBD |||||| NAVY USE OF ABILITYONE SUPPORT CONTRACTOR - RELEASE OF OFFEROR INFORMATION (3-18))|1|| MANDATORY USE OF WORKFLOW PRO (WFP) MOD ASSIST MODULE|1|| WARRANTY OF SUPPLIES OF A NONCOMPLEX NATURE (JUN 2003)|6|12 MONTHS|60 DAYS AFTER DISCOVERY OF DEFECT||||| EQUAL OPPORTUITY FOR WORKERS WITH DISABILITIES (DEV 2026-O0040)(FEB 2026)|4||||| BUY AMERICAN-FREE TRADE AGREEMENTS-BALANCE OF PAYMENTS PROGRAM-BASIC (FEB 2024)|11|||||||||||| SECURITY PROHIBITIONS AND EXCLUSIONS (CLASS DEVIATION 2026-O0025)(FEB 2026)|7|||||||| BUY AMERICAN-FREE TRADE AGREEMENTS-BALANCE OF PAYMENTS PROGRAM CERTIFICATE-BASIC (FEB 2024))|5|||||| BUY AMERICAN--BALANCE OF PAYMENTS PROGRAM CERTIFICATE-BASIC (FEB 2024)|1|| ALTERNATE A, ANNUAL REPRESENTATIONS AND CERTIFICATIONS (DEVIATION 2026-O0043)(FEB 2026))|13|||||||||||||| ROYALTY INFORMATION (APR 1984)|1|| NOTICE OF PRIORITY RATING FOR NATIONAL DEFENSE, EMERGENCY PREPAREDNESS, ANDENERGY PROGRAM USE (APR 2008))|2||X| THIS SOLICITATION IS FOR THE FURNISHING OF : NSN: 0QM 5315 017216798 SX PN: CL-5-BLPB-1.00-S QUANTITY: 2 EA PLEASE SUBMIT QUOTE VIA EMAIL TO RYAN.P.STOCK2.CIV@US.NAVY.MIL BY THE DUE DATE SPECIFIED ON PAGE 1, BLOCK 10. THESE ITEMS REQUIRE GOVERNMENT SOURCE APPROVAL PRIOR TO AWARD. IF YOU ARE NOT AN APPROVED SOURCE, YOU MUST SUBMIT, TOGETHER WITH YOUR PROPOSAL, THE INFORMATION DETAILED IN THE NAVSUP WSS SOURCE APPROVAL BROCHURE WHICH CAN BE OBTAINED ONLINE AT https://www.navsup.navy.mil/public/navsup/wss/business_opps/ UNDER "COMMODITIES." OFFERS RECEIVED WHICH FAIL TO PROVIDE ALL DATA REQUIRED BY THE SOURCE APPROVAL BROCHURE WILL NOT BE CONSIDERED FOR AWARD UNDER THIS SOLICITATION. PLEASE NOTE, IF EVALUATION OF A SOURCE APPROVAL REQUEST SUBMITTED HEREUNDER CANNOT BE PROCESSED IN TIME AND / OR APPROVAL REQUIREMENTS PRECLUDE THE ABILITY TO OBTAIN SUBJECT ITEMS IN TIME TO MEET GOVERNMENT REQUIREMENTS, AWARD OF REQUIREMENT MAY BE CONTINUED BASED ON FLEET SUPPORT NEEDS.
